During an in-home consultation, I meet with you and your baby in the comfort of your home so we can fully assess feeding in a relaxed environment.
Appointments typically last 1.5–2 hours and include:
• a detailed health and breastfeeding history
• observation of a feeding at the breast
• guidance on latch and positioning adjustments
• tongue and lip tie assessment
• feeding weight checks using a hospital-grade infant scale
Together we create a personalized feeding plan designed to help you reach your breastfeeding goals and feel confident supporting your baby’s feeding needs.

What Is Overnight Newborn Care?
Often referred to as a night nurse, night nanny, or overnight doula, this type of support provides care for your baby overnight while you sleep.
As a Board Certified Lactation Consultant (IBCLC), my approach goes beyond traditional overnight care.
You receive both hands-on newborn care and real-time breastfeeding guidance throughout the night, helping you protect your milk supply while getting the rest your body needs.
